  3. here i am again...

     

    so i have this algorithm that computes the current academic year for our school..

    it outputs the correct academic year on a browser..

    but when i try to insert it into my database, the data inserted goes wrong..

     

    it just keeps on inserting -1 instead of the string 2011-2012

     

    here's my code:

    <?php
    
    $year = date('Y');
    $currentyear = $year;
    $lastyear = $year - 1;
    $nextyear = $year + 1;
    
    if (date('m') < 6)
    {
     $current_ay = $lastyear."-".$currentyear;
    }
    else
    if (date('m') >= 6)
    {
     $current_ay = $currentyear."-".$nextyear;
    }
    
    echo $current_ay;
      $insertSQL = "INSERT INTO tbl_elections (election_id) values ($current_ay)";
    
      mysql_select_db($database_organizazone_db, $organizazone_db);
      $Result1 = mysql_query($insertSQL, $organizazone_db) or die(mysql_error());
    
    ?>

     

     

    *the database column to be inserted into is of varchar data type
